Effective budgeting isn’t just about cutting expenses—it’s about redirecting cash flow toward high-impact financial goals. At its core, budgeting like a professional involves mapping income against spending, identifying waste, and investing surplus funds into opportunities with compounding returns. The $10k target in 30 days works not through overnight magic, but through disciplined habits: tracking every dollar, eliminating non-essential costs, automating savings, and reallocating freed-up funds toward income-generating activities. Real data and long-term behavior studies show that consistent saving and smart allocation lay the foundation for rapid balance growth—even from modest starting points. These steps, when executed with clarity and persistence, transform a long-term goal into a near-term reality.
